From: Muhammad Falak R Wani Date: Sun, 25 Oct 2015 10:43:25 +0000 (+0530) Subject: staging: hfi1: sdma: Use setup_timer X-Git-Tag: v4.14-rc1~4420^2~160 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=daac731ba815ef0669d99db5a6a176bac567e156;p=platform%2Fkernel%2Flinux-rpi.git staging: hfi1: sdma: Use setup_timer Use the timer API function setup_timer instead of init_timer, removing the structure field assignments. Signed-off-by: Muhammad Falak R Wani Signed-off-by: Greg Kroah-Hartman --- diff --git a/drivers/staging/rdma/hfi1/sdma.c b/drivers/staging/rdma/hfi1/sdma.c index 63ab721..16d93ff 100644 --- a/drivers/staging/rdma/hfi1/sdma.c +++ b/drivers/staging/rdma/hfi1/sdma.c @@ -1094,10 +1094,8 @@ int sdma_init(struct hfi1_devdata *dd, u8 port) sde->progress_check_head = 0; - init_timer(&sde->err_progress_check_timer); - sde->err_progress_check_timer.function = - sdma_err_progress_check; - sde->err_progress_check_timer.data = (unsigned long)sde; + setup_timer(&sde->err_progress_check_timer, + sdma_err_progress_check, (unsigned long)sde); sde->descq = dma_zalloc_coherent( &dd->pcidev->dev,